Alternative Method
Believe it or not, every cell phone number has an email address. To get that address, check the list of email addresses below for various wireless companies. Or, have a friend send you an MMS to your email address. Access the email message on your iPhone and check out the “From:” field. That is your friend’s cell phone’s email address. Emailing a picture to that address will show up as an MMS on their phone. You can add that address to your contacts. Voila, you can now send MMS messages to your friend’s phone.
Just make sure your friend’s phone can receive MMS messages (ie, you can’t email the MMS to an iPhone).
*Update* There have been a mix of successes and failures using this method. Please ad your details to the comments below so we know which addresses work and don’t work.
These addresses are for US-based carriers. The Xs are the 10 digit phone number:

Some things to try:
1. On your iPhone, go into Settings–>General, scroll down to Resetand tap Reset Network Settings. Note that if you have WiFi network settings on the iPhone, you’ll have to reenter them after resetting.
2. Try sending just a regular text message. If you can’t, there may be other problems like your account is not set up to send text messages or you have the wrong phone number.
3. If you are roaming outside of your call area, you have to have Data Roamingturned on in the iPhone’s settings. To turn it on, go into Settings–>General–>Network and slide the Data Roaming tab to On. Note that roaming charges may start to apply.
4. Some carriers have limits for the size of MMS messages. Try sending a smaller photo or even a short voice memo as a test. AT&T Wireless limits MMS messages to 600KB.
